Im drowning in spreadsheets right now. My team is based in Chicago and we have this massive project due in three weeks where we have to manually pull client info from PDFs into our CRM and honestly I am going insane. Ive looked online and saw people recommending Zapier but it seems like it might be overkill for the specific messy invoice formats we have, then I saw people mention UiPath but that looks like it takes a PhD to set up properly, you know? I dont have a huge budget, maybe like 50 to 100 bucks a month max if the tool is really good.

Here is what I actually need:

  • Must handle unstructured PDF data (invoices/receipts)
  • Needs to integrate with Salesforce if possible
  • Very low learning curve because I cant afford to spend a week learning code
  • Budget under 100/mo

Is there anything else out there that actually works for this kind of tedious grunt work without needing a whole IT department? My eyes are literally crossing from staring at these numbers all day...

I feel your pain, honestly. I spent months manually transferring billing data until my vision was basically blurred 24/7. You really dont need to overcomplicate this with enterprise software that takes forever to train. Before you drop a fortune on a consultant, check out some easier automation tools that handle document parsing without needing a dev team.

  • Rossum AI Data Extraction is honestly a lifesaver for those messy, unstructured invoice formats.
  • Bardeen AI Automation has a super low learning curve and works great for scraping data directly into your browser. Just be careful with the accuracy when you first start, make sure to audit the first batch of entries manually just in case. Itll save you from having to clean up a giant mess in your CRM later. Dont lose your mind over these spreadsheets, you can definitely automate this within your budget.

Jumping in here because I have been in your shoes and it honestly sucks. I tried using some of the bigger platforms back in the day and honestly, they were such a headache to configure for messy invoices that I eventually just gave up. Unfortunately, a lot of those popular tools promise the moon but then you spend three weeks just trying to get a simple field mapping to stick. It is super frustrating when you are on a deadline. Before I steer you toward some other options, are your PDFs mostly scanned images or are they digitally generated text? That makes a massive difference in how much of a headache the extraction process is gonna be. If you want something that is actually plug and play, have you looked into Rossum AI Cloud Document Extraction? It is pretty solid for invoices and handles the unstructured stuff way better than the generic automation platforms. Another one people in my circle like is Docparser Cloud PDF Parser. It is surprisingly intuitive for that price point and usually sits under 100 bucks depending on your volume. I had some minor issues with their UI being a bit dated a year or two ago, but it did the job when I needed it to stop the manual entry madness. Let me know about the PDF type and I can tell you if those will actually play nice with your current setup.
